Understanding Hair Damage

Before diving into the best products, it’s important to understand what causes hair damage. Common culprits include:

  • Heat Styling: Frequent use of blow dryers, straighteners, and curling irons can weaken hair, leading to breakage.
  • Chemical Treatments: Hair dyes, relaxers, and perms can strip hair of its natural moisture and cause structural damage.
  • Environmental Factors: UV rays, humidity, and pollution can contribute to dryness and brittleness.
  • Poor Nutrition: Lack of essential vitamins and minerals can affect hair health, leading to thinning and damage.

Recognizing these factors is the first step toward choosing the right products for repair and maintenance.

1. Olaplex No. 3 Hair Perfector

Olaplex has taken the hair care industry by storm with its innovative bond-building technology. The No. 3 Hair Perfector is a treatment that works on a molecular level to repair broken bonds in the hair. It is suitable for all hair types and can be used as a weekly treatment. To use, apply to damp hair, leave it on for at least 10 minutes, and then rinse. Users have reported significant improvements in hair texture and strength after just a few applications.

Additional Tips for Hair Repair

In addition to using the right products, consider the following tips for maintaining and repairing damaged hair:

  • Avoid Heat: Try to limit the use of heat styling tools. When you do use them, always apply a heat protectant.
  • Trim Regularly: Regular trims help to remove split ends and prevent further damage.
  • Stay Hydrated: Drink plenty of water and incorporate a balanced diet rich in vitamins and minerals to support hair health.
  • Protect Hair from the Sun: Wear hats or use UV protection products to shield your hair from harsh sun rays.
  • Choose Gentle Products: Avoid sulfates and harsh chemicals in your hair care products to minimize damage.
